In the modern world, technology plays an integral role in our daily lives, and one of the remarkable advancements in communication and navigation is the establishment of a radio beacon station. A radio beacon station is a facility that transmits radio signals to assist in the navigation of aircraft, ships, and other vehicles. These stations are crucial for ensuring safe travel, especially in areas where visual navigation is challenging due to weather conditions or geographical obstacles.The primary function of a radio beacon station is to provide a reliable reference point for navigators. By emitting continuous radio waves, these stations enable pilots and mariners to determine their position accurately. The signals broadcasted from a radio beacon station can be received by instruments on board aircraft and vessels, allowing them to calculate their distance and direction from the beacon. This capability is essential for maintaining safety and avoiding collisions, particularly in busy airspace or crowded waterways.Moreover, radio beacon stations serve as an essential component of search and rescue operations. When an aircraft or vessel is in distress, they can send a distress signal that can be picked up by nearby radio beacon stations. These stations can then relay the information to rescue teams, significantly speeding up the response time and increasing the chances of survival for those in danger.In addition to their navigational and safety functions, radio beacon stations also play a vital role in scientific research and data collection. Many of these stations are equipped with advanced technology that allows them to gather atmospheric data and monitor environmental changes. This information can be invaluable for meteorologists and researchers studying climate patterns and natural phenomena.The technology behind radio beacon stations has evolved significantly over the years. Early beacons were simple devices that transmitted a single frequency, but modern stations utilize multiple frequencies and advanced modulation techniques to improve accuracy and reliability. As a result, contemporary radio beacon stations can provide real-time updates and enhanced services to users, making navigation safer and more efficient than ever before.Furthermore, the integration of radio beacon stations with satellite systems has revolutionized navigation. While traditional beacons rely on ground-based signals, satellite technology enables global coverage and precise positioning. This synergy between terrestrial and satellite systems ensures that navigators have access to the most accurate information available, regardless of their location.In conclusion, radio beacon stations are indispensable assets in our increasingly interconnected world.
